As a Senior Product Manager, Trauma & Extremities, you will join Stryker’s fast-growing Trauma & Extremities (T&E) division in Israel and play a key role in shaping the future of orthopaedics. You’ll collaborate with passionate marketers in a very international team, driving impactful marketing initiatives and bringing exciting innovations to market. This is a unique career opportunity to grow your expertise, influence the T&E portfolio, and make a tangible difference for patients and healthcare providers. At Stryker, your ideas and impact truly matter.

What you will do:

  • Author and leverage marketing teammates to create key strategy documents: strategic plan, annual marketing plan, product launch plans, etc

  • Surface new or unexpressed customer needs, leading to product/program improvements

  • Adhere to organizational protocols, practices and procedures for gathering competitive information

  • Drive segmentation and targeting methods to improve commercial efficiency

  • Develop pricing approach consistent with the marketing strategy and brand positioning

  • Accurately forecast resource needs

  • Establish metrics and goals/success criteria and milestones

  • Demonstrate financial acumen

  • Hold self and others accountable to deliver high quality results with passion, energy, and drive to meet business priorities

  • Mentor, develop and inspire others

  • Collaborate and influence others on cross-functional teams, advancing partnerships to achieve business objectives

  • Develop key relationships with industry/market thought leaders, organizations, and institutions, in collaboration with other marketing leaders

What You Will Need

Required:

  • Bachelor’s degree required

  • 6+ years of work experience required

  • 3+ years of marketing or sales experience in medical device industry

  • Proficiency in English

  • Excellent presentation and interpersonal communications skills

  • Strong analytical and problem-solving skills

  • Demonstrated proficiency in Microsoft Office (Excel, Word & PowerPoint)

  • Must be able to understand and work within complex interdivisional procedures and policies

Preferred

  • Experience in Trauma & Extremities, Orthopaedics, or related fields is highly desirable

  • MBA preferred

  • Ability to manage multiple projects while delivering on established timelines

  • Ability to be persuasive in the absence of organizational authority

Travel Percentage: 50%
